Children with chronic intestinal failure (IF) can now survive into adulthood with parenteral nutrition (PN) support. Management focuses on growth, minimizing complications, and achieving intestinal autonomy, with newer treatments like GLP-2 analogues offering improved outcomes.

Background:

  • Chronic intestinal failure (IF) impacts children, necessitating long-term parenteral nutrition (PN) support for survival.
  • Major causes include short bowel syndrome (SBS), intestinal dysmotility, and mucosal diseases, with SBS being most common in infancy post-necrotizing enterocolitis (NEC).

Main Results:

  • Children with IF can achieve survival into adulthood with appropriate PN support.
  • Effective management involves multidisciplinary care, early enteral feeding, PN optimization, and parental training for home care.
  • GLP-2 analogues represent a promising advancement in treating SBS.

Conclusions:

  • Optimized multidisciplinary care in specialized intestinal rehabilitation centers is crucial for successful IF management.
  • A combination of conservative strategies and novel therapies can improve outcomes and promote intestinal autonomy.
  • Long-term survival and quality of life for children with IF are significantly enhanced through comprehensive management approaches.

Understanding the physiological differences in the pediatric population is crucial for effective pharmacotherapy. Neonates, infants, and children exhibit significant variations in gastric pH, gastric emptying time, intestinal transit time, and biliary function. The administration of drugs via parenteral routes allows for direct drug introduction into the systemic circulation, resulting in high bioavailability because the medication bypasses the harsh conditions of the gastrointestinal tract and hepatic metabolism.
The intravenous route (IV) of drug administration can be further categorized into two types. The bolus injection administers the entire dose rapidly, while an intravenous infusion slowly delivers smaller doses steadily.
